Comparison of accident characteristics between manual materials handling (MMH) and non-MMH works in the automobile parts manufacturing industry: Based on South Korea and the US.

作者信息

Yang Seung Tae, Jeong Byung Yong

机构信息

Korean Industrial Health Association, Health Management, Republic of Korea.

Department of Industrial and Management Engineering, Hansung University, Republic of Korea.

出版信息

Work. 2019;62(2):197-203. doi: 10.3233/WOR-192855.

Abstract

BACKGROUND

Despite ergonomic improvements in the workplace of automobile parts manufacturing industry, many jobs still require workers to perform repetitive tasks or manual material handling.

OBJECTIVE

This study compares the characteristics of occupational injuries between MMH and non-MMH in the automobile parts manufacturing industry based in South Korea and the US.

METHODS

Occupational injuries were analyzed by age, work experience, company size, employment type, injury severity, work type, type of accident, agency of accident, injured part of body, and injury type.

RESULTS

Among 1,530 injuries, 271 people (17.7%) were MMH injuries, and 1,259 people (82.3%) were non-MMH injuries. The rate of MMH injury was higher in the logistics process, in the work experience with more than 10 years, and in the company size with more than 100 employees than that of the non-MMH injury. Also, the rate of MMH injury was higher in the types of sprain and herniated discs, and in the injured part of trunk/back, leg/foot, and shoulder than that of the non-MMH injury.

CONCLUSIONS

The results of this study can be used as essential data for establishing a systematic preventive policy for industrial accidents in the automobile parts manufacturing industry.

摘要

背景

尽管汽车零部件制造业的工作场所进行了工效学改进,但许多工作仍要求工人执行重复性任务或进行手工物料搬运。

目的

本研究比较了韩国和美国汽车零部件制造业中手工物料搬运(MMH)作业和非MMH作业的职业伤害特征。

方法

从年龄、工作经验、公司规模、就业类型、伤害严重程度、工作类型、事故类型、事故发生机构、身体受伤部位和伤害类型等方面对职业伤害进行分析。

结果

在1530起伤害事件中,271人(17.7%)为MMH伤害,1259人(82.3%)为非MMH伤害。在物流流程中、工作经验超过10年的员工以及员工规模超过100人的公司中,MMH伤害发生率高于非MMH伤害。此外,扭伤和椎间盘突出类型以及躯干/背部、腿部/脚部和肩部受伤部位的MMH伤害发生率高于非MMH伤害。

结论

本研究结果可作为为汽车零部件制造业工业事故制定系统预防政策的重要数据。
